Nicole is a 4-time New York Press Association award-winning writer from The Bronx, New York. She graduated in 2019, with a bachelor's degree in Media Studies and Journalism from Mercy College.

Her passion for community storytelling blossomed during her time as the Managing Editor of her college publication, The Impact, where she covered local news in Westchester County. She’s experienced in all verticals of media. She loves to create engaging and unique content whether it’s through social media, copywriting, digital marketing, or public relations projects.

Nicole was a reporter at Daily Voice and covered Berks, Bucks, Chester, Delaware, Lehigh and Montgomery counties in Pennsylvania.

Family Displaced After Fire Breaks Out In Pottstown Home: Report Firefighters helped knock down a Monday, Aug. 29 blaze that broke out in a Pottstown home, displacing a family, WFMZ reports. A resident was able to stop the fire from spreading by shutting a bedroom door inside the house on the 1200 block of Maple Street around 10:40 p.m., the outlet says. Alcohol Thought To Be Factor In Crash That Killed Driver With No Headlights In Bucks Co.: PD Alcohol was believed to have played a factor in a crash that killed a driver in Bucks County, authorities said. An unidentified man was traveling on the 800 block of Trenton Road in a vehicle with its headlights off when he struck another vehicle that was backing into a driveway around 10 p.m. on Saturday, Aug. 27, Falls Township police said. The first driver was taken to Jefferson Hospital, where he was pronounced dead, police said. The second driver was left with minor injuries.
